Problem

Existing spraying devices for fragrances, deodorizing agents, and sanitizing fluids lack directional control, leading to inefficient material distribution and difficulties in replacing aerosol canisters due to unclear actuator arm positions, which can result in material wastage and potential damage.

Innovation Solution

A spray device with an actuator arm incorporating position indication means, such as a projection that moves between activation and retracted positions, and position adjustment means, allowing users to clearly visualize the arm's position and adjust it, ensuring proper canister insertion and reducing contact pressure with the spray head.

Data Source

PatentUS8695849B2Spray device
Publication Date: 2014.04.15 RECKITT BENCKISER (UK) LTD

AI summary

A spray device comprises spray container receiving means and spray container actuation means (102, 126), wherein the spray container actuation means are adapted to periodically cause ejection of spray material from a spray container (116) by means of an actuator arm (102), wherein the actuator arm (102) incorporates position indication means (144).
